no reading temp, oil and fuel level gauges?
i just started helping my friends son get his first fb going, he bought it not running, it would almost fire and stall, and flood. so with in 2 hours i corrected several vacuum system issues,and found the shutter valve wired closed with a properly functioning shutter valve, and some wiring and she fired right up. but only have a reading on the voltage gauge, and tach. no oil pressure (put in a mechanical to check and it has pressure), coolant temp, and fuel gauges are all dead, and its got a buzzer with key in the ignition, that goes away when the car starts, kinda like the coolant level buzzer but no coolant light on, and coolant is full. Ive checked fuses, tested sensor resistance, and wire continuity, WTF do i do next?????
any ideas???? should i be looking behind the gauge cluster or is this gonna be somewhere else?
car is completely stock 85 gs
the previous owner wired in a factory fuel pump direct to the battery, as the factory connector is supposedly dead(i gonna get that figured out next time im there)
